Tata Steel

Tata Steel (BSE: 500470), formerly known as TISCO and Tata Iron and Steel Company Limited, is the world's seventh largest steel company, with an annual crude steel capacity of 31 million tonnes. It is the largest private sector steel company in India in terms of domestic production. Ranked 258th on Fortune Global 500, it is based in Jamshedpur, Jharkhand, India. It is part of Tata Group  of companies.

Tata Steel raises stake in Australia's Riversdale

Tata Steel, the world's No. 7 steelmaker, has raised its stake in Riversdale Mining to more than 27 percent, making it harder for miner Rio Tinto to seal its $3.9 billion bid for the Mozambique-focused coal miner.

Tata Steel, L&T, Lakshmi Machine get FDI nod

Tata Steel, the world's No. 7 steelmaker, has received government approval to raise 11 billion rupees through issue of warrants to overseas investors, the Press Information bureau said in a statement on Thursday.

Tata Steel Q2 net profit jumps at 19.79 bln rupees

Tata Steel, the world's seventh largest steel company, has said its consolidated net profit after tax increased 8.5 percent to 19.79 billion rupees ($440 million) for the second quarter higher than the profit of 18.25 billion rupees ($406 million) in Q1 FY’11.
